Style Versatility: From Rustic to Regal

One of the standout qualities of a wooden designer cabinet is its ability to suit almost any design aesthetic. Whether you favor rustic warmth or sleek modernism, you can find a cabinet that resonates with your space:

  • Rustic & Farmhouse: Use unfinished or lightly stained wood, iron handles, and open shelving for a cozy, countryside feel.

  • Modern Minimalist: Think clean lines, smooth finishes, and push-to-open doors—perfect for contemporary apartments.

  • Classic & Colonial: Rich tones, ornate carvings, and brass accents add elegance to more traditional interiors.

  • Boho Chic: Combine reclaimed wood, colorful paints, and asymmetrical layouts for an eclectic vibe.

Maintenance and Longevity

Despite its delicate appeal, a wooden designer cabinet is relatively easy to maintain. With regular care, it can stay beautiful for decades:

  • Wipe dust using a soft, dry cloth.

  • Avoid placing it in direct sunlight or near heat sources.

  • Use mats or Luxury handcrafted wooden coasters to prevent water rings or heat damage.

  • Polish or oil the wood occasionally to maintain its luster and prevent drying.
